Gutierrez penalized for Maldonado collision

Sauber’s Esteban Gutierrez will drop three places on the grid at the next round in Germany after Silverstone stewards decided he was ‘predominantly at fault’ for a coming-together with Lotus’s Pastor Maldonado during Sunday’s 2014 Formula 1 Santander British Grand Prix.
Maldonado’s car was launched into the air in spectacular fashion after Gutierrez made an ambitious passing attempt on the Venezuelan down the inside at Vale, less than 10 laps into the race.
Gutierrez’s afternoon ended soon after when he went off into the gravel with accident damage. Maldonado was able to continue, but ultimately retired after 49 laps with technical problems and was classified 17th.
